The question of whether you can get a cash refund at GameStop is a common one, and the answer isn’t always straightforward. It depends on several factors, including the original payment method, the item’s condition, and whether you have a receipt. In short: Yes, GameStop does offer cash refunds in certain situations, primarily when the original purchase was made with cash or a debit card, but it’s crucial to understand the specific policies to avoid any confusion.
Understanding GameStop’s Refund Policy
GameStop’s return and refund policy is designed to be fair while also protecting their inventory. It’s important to note that GameStop does not offer cash refunds for purchases made with a credit card in most circumstances. This is standard practice for many retailers, as credit card refunds are typically processed back to the original card.
Cash Refunds
If you made a purchase using cash, you typically have a higher likelihood of receiving a cash refund, especially for purchases under $150. For cash purchases over $150, GameStop may offer a refund to an ATM (debit) card rather than providing physical cash. This is likely for security reasons and to avoid handling large amounts of cash.
Debit Card Refunds
Purchases made with a debit card often have more flexible refund options than those made with credit cards. Debit card refunds can sometimes be issued in cash at the store location where the return is made. However, as with cash refunds over $150, they might opt to refund back to your debit card. Keep in mind, the speed of debit card refunds is typically faster than that of credit cards. In-person returns at a GameStop location can sometimes yield an immediate refund back to a debit card.
Credit Card Refunds
When you make a purchase with a credit card, GameStop usually processes the refund back to the original credit card. This is a standard policy and means you won’t typically receive a cash refund for these types of purchases. It can take between three to seven business days for the refund to appear in your account.
Gift Receipts and Exchanges
If you received an item as a gift and have a gift receipt, you won’t be eligible for a cash refund. Instead, GameStop will offer you an exchange or a gift card of equal value.
Important Conditions for Returns and Refunds
Regardless of the payment method, there are some crucial conditions you need to adhere to when seeking a refund or return at GameStop:
- Time Frame: Returns are generally accepted within 30 days of the packing slip’s date.
- Product Condition: The item must be in its original, unopened condition. This means the plastic wrap should still be intact, and the item should have all its original parts.
- Original Receipt or Proof of Purchase: You must have your original receipt or other proof of purchase. If you don’t have a receipt, the return process might be more difficult or not possible.
- No Opened Items: GameStop does not accept returns of any products that have been opened (taken out of its plastic wrap).
- No Damaged or Used Items: Items that are damaged, played, or missing parts cannot be returned.
Can I Get Cash Back on Trade-Ins?
While technically not a refund, it’s worth noting that GameStop also allows customers to trade in games and accessories. When trading in items, you generally have two options: in-store credit or cash. In-store credit typically provides a higher value for your items. If you choose cash, you’ll receive a lesser amount than the store credit, but you will receive physical cash for your trade-in. This is a great option if you’re looking for an immediate cash payout. Also, remember that GameStop Pro Members often receive an additional 10% in value on most traded-in items.
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s) about GameStop Refunds
1. What happens if my refund doesn’t show up on my credit card?
Ideally, a credit card refund should appear in your account within 7 business days. If it doesn’t, you should first contact GameStop to verify if they have processed the refund. If they confirm the refund has been issued, then contact your credit card issuer for further assistance.
2. Can I get a cash refund if I paid with a prepaid card?
The process for refunds to prepaid cards can vary. Most banks or card issuers will either refund to the original prepaid card or provide a replacement if the original card is no longer available. Contact GameStop and your card issuer directly for the best solution.
3. What if I don’t have my physical credit card for a refund?
Most retailers, including GameStop, need the original credit card used to process a refund. However, some may be able to retrieve the information from the receipt. It is always better to have the original card to ensure a smooth process.
4. Can I cancel my GameStop order and get a full refund?
Yes, you can cancel an order and get a refund, provided the order is not too far into the processing cycle. You can contact GameStop customer service by phone at 1-800-883-8895, 7 days a week, from 8:00 AM to 8:00 PM (CST). Also, check your order details online for self-service options.
5. What happens if I don’t pick up my pre-ordered game?
GameStop will typically sell your pre-ordered game to another customer. However, they will still refund the amount of money you put down towards the purchase.
6. Can I return a game if I opened it?
No. GameStop does not accept returns of opened games. The item must be in its original sealed packaging.
7. How long do I have to return a game for a full refund?
You generally have up to 30 days from the date on the packing slip to return a game, provided that it meets all other requirements including unopened packaging.
